A system should keep improving after it goes live.

This stage is about making sure the system remains practical, reliable, and useful in real business conditions. We review how the system is being used, identify where small improvements could make it easier to manage, and help keep the workflow aligned with the outcomes it was designed to support.

What we support

  • Early questions or issues that arise once the system is being used.
  • Small refinements to forms, workflows, notifications, or handover steps.
  • Adjustments to reporting, visibility, or tracking where needed.
  • Practical guidance for users who need help understanding the system.
  • Review of whether the setup is still aligned to the agreed business process.
  • Minor improvements that help the system work more smoothly in daily use.

What optimisation may include

  • Improving steps that feel too manual, slow, or unclear after launch.
  • Refining automations or notifications based on real usage.
  • Improving how information is captured, routed, or reported.
  • Adding sensible enhancements once the first version is stable.
  • Removing unnecessary steps that do not add practical value.
  • Helping the system scale as enquiry volume, team needs, or business priorities change.
